OJJDP accomplishes its mission by supporting states, local communities, and tribal jurisdictions in their efforts to develop and implement effective and coordinated prevention and intervention programs for juveniles. The Office of Juvenile Justice and Delinquency Prevention (or OJJDP) is an office of the United States Department of Justice and a component of the Office of Justice Programs.. OJJDP sponsors research, program, and training initiatives; develops priorities and goals and sets policies to guide federal juvenile justice issues. The Office of Juvenile Justice and Delinquency Prevention (OJJDP) is a component of the U.S. Department of Justice and the Office of Justice Programs.
